Random bytes from the Animica node's randomness service with a signed digest attestation and an entropy-health report, 1..1024 bytes per draw. Current trust model, stated up front and in every response: the entropy source is a software CSPRNG (os.urandom) and the signer is a software key, so source.is_quantum=false and attestation.attested=false today; those fields flip truthfully if a hardware/quantum provider is ever connected. The free catalog entry carries the same live entropy block, so you can check the source before paying.

Scan retrieved content — a fetched page, an email, a tool result — for text trying to manipulate the agent reading it: instruction overrides, role/system impersonation, exfiltration requests, hidden or encoded directives. Returns a risk score, the suspicious spans verbatim, and the technique observed. Deterministic pattern checks run ALONGSIDE the model so a blatant "ignore all previous instructions" is caught even if the model misses it, and the two signals are reported separately rather than blended into one number you cannot interrogate. Audit whether a website can actually be read, quoted and cited by AI agents, and get a prioritised fix list. Probes the homepage as each real AI crawler (GPTBot, OAI-SearchBot, ChatGPT-User, ClaudeBot, Claude-User, PerplexityBot, CCBot, meta-externalagent, Amazonbot) to catch the 429s, 403s and soft-404s that make a live site invisible; parses robots.txt per agent including the robots-only training tokens Google-Extended and Applebot-Extended; and checks llms.txt, structured data, machine-readable endpoints (OpenAPI, MCP, x402, well-known), sitemap, canonical and title/meta, plus how much of the page survives with JavaScript off. Fully deterministic — no model is called, so the same site scores the same twice. It does NOT ask ChatGPT or Perplexity whether they have heard of your brand; it measures the inputs that decide whether they can.

Give a URL and a question; get an answer grounded in that page, WITH the passages the answer was drawn from. We fetch the page, chunk it, embed the chunks and your question, retrieve the closest 4 passages and answer from those only. Nothing is stored — it is a one-shot pipeline, not an index. The retrieved passages come back with the answer so you can check it rather than trust it, and when nothing on the page is relevant the product says so instead of letting the model improvise. Reaches the public internet only, with the same SSRF protections as the fetch product.

Anchor a SHA-256 digest (or a small document, which we hash for you) into the Animica data-availability layer and get back a commitment plus a Merkle inclusion proof anyone can check without trusting us. The record is erasure-coded across shards and committed to a Merkle root; the response carries the commitment, the leaf index and sibling path, and the chain head height and hash observed at the moment of anchoring. Verification is FREE and permanent at GET /x402/notarize/verify/{commitment} — a notarisation nobody can check would be worth nothing. Note precisely what this proves: the record is committed in this node's DA tree under the returned commitment, alongside the head it observed. That is not the same as a timestamp signed by the whole consensus set, and the response says so rather than blurring the two.

Fetch a public web page and return clean readable text with its title and metadata - the form a model can actually use, with navigation, scripts and styling removed. Follows up to 3 redirects, caps the download at 2000000 bytes and gives up after 15000ms. Reaches the PUBLIC internet only: the hostname is resolved and every redirect hop re-checked against private, loopback, link-local and CGNAT ranges, so this cannot read internal services or cloud metadata. Returns raw HTML too on request.

Uniform integers in [min, max] derived from ONE verified randomness draw by rejection sampling (never modulo bias) — up to 1000 per request. The response carries the raw draw, the node's source/health/attestation and the exact rule, so you can recompute every integer offline.
